Metadatadefinitioner för ett objekt för elektronisk signatur
För att automatiska signaturobjekt ska kunna skapas i M-Files måste du skapa alias för den nya objekttypen samt för de egenskapsdefinitioner som krävs. Alias används för att skapa objekt då signeringen sker. Om du använder M-Files Compliance Kit bör dessa definitioner redan finnas tillgängliga. Annars bör du skapa metadatadefinitionerna nedan för att aktivera de separata signaturobjekten.
Objekttyp
Skapa en ny objekttyp och ge den ett namn, till exempel objekttypen Signatur. Ange objekttypalias i de avancerade inställningarna:
M-Files.QMS.Signature.ObjectType
Nödvändiga egenskapsdefinitioner för signaturobjektet
När du har skapat den nya objekttypen skapar M-Files automatiskt en motsvarande egenskapsdefinition. Välj den här egenskapsdefinitionen i egenskapsdefinitioner och lägg till följande alias:
M-Files.QMS.Signatures
Lägg även till de egenskapsdefinitioner i listan nedan:
Föreslaget egenskapsnamn | Alias | Datatyp | Beskrivning |
---|---|---|---|
Identifier | M-Files.QMS.Signature.Identifier | Text | Identifieraregenskapen läggs till i den elektroniska signaturen när objektet för den elektroniska signaturen skapas. Värdet för identifieraregenskap anges i inställningarna för den elektroniska signaturen i M-Files Admin. |
Orsak till signatur | M-Files.QMS.Signature.Reason | Text | En kort beskrivning på rubriknivå för signaturen. |
Signaturens betydelse | M-Files.QMS.Signature.Meaning | Text (flerradig) | En beskrivning som gör att den som signerar förstår vad som godkänns. |
Den som signerar | M-Files.QMS.Signature.Signer | Välj från listan Användare | Den valvanvändare som elektroniskt signerar tillståndsövergången. |
Användare | M-Files.QMS.Signature.User | Välj från listan Användare | Den valvanvändare till vars identitet signaturen är bunden när signaturen används för att flytta en uppgift till ett slutligt tillstånd, till exempel Slutförd, Godkänd eller Nekad. |
Du kan ge de nödvändiga egenskapsdefinitionerna som nämns ovan namn som du väljer, men de bör vara så beskrivande som möjligt eftersom den informationen visas i signaturobjektets metadata.
Valfria egenskapsdefinitioner för signaturobjektet
Du kan även skapa olika valfria egenskapsdefinitioner för signaturobjektet. Du kan till exempel vilja skapa en ny egenskapsdefinition för ytterligare signaturinformation med datatypen Text (flerradig) och lägg till följande alias:
M-Files.QMS.Signature.AdditionalInfo
Resten av de valfria egenskaperna listas nedan:
Alias | Datatyp | Beskrivning |
---|---|---|
M-Files.QMS.Signature.Signer.Name | Text | Innehåller fullständigt namn för den som signerar. |
M-Files.QMS.Signature.Signer.Account | Text | Innehåller M-Files-kontonamnet för den som signerar. |
M-Files.QMS.Signature.LocalTimestampText | Text | Den lokala tiden för signaturen som text, inklusive information om tidszonen. |
M-Files.QMS.Signature.UTCTimestampText | Text | UTC-tiden för signaturen som text, inklusive information om tidszonen. |
M-Files.QMS.Signature.UTCTimestamp | Tidsstämpel | UTC-tidsstämpeln för signaturen. |
M-Files.QMS.Signature.Date | Datum | Signaturdatum i lokal (server)tid. |
M-Files.QMS.Signature.FromState | Välj från listan Tillstånd | Arbetsflödestillståndet före tillståndsövergången. Är bara tillgängligt när tillståndsövergångar signeras. |
M-Files.QMS.Signature.ToState | Välj från listan Tillstånd | Arbetsflödestillståndet efter tillståndsövergången. Är bara tillgängligt när tillståndsövergångar signeras. |
M-Files.QMS.Signature.StateTransition | Välj från listan Tillståndsövergångar | Det arbetsflödestillstånd som har utförts. Är bara tillgängligt när tillståndsövergångar signeras. |
Utförda, tomma och ogiltigförklarade signaturobjekt och hur du ska använda dem
Du kan även skapa så kallade tomma signaturobjekt och använda dem för att övervaka vilka signaturer som ännu inte har signerats och vilka som redan har utförts. Du kan använda dessa tomma, utförda och ogiltigförklarade signaturobjekt och skapa olika klasser för signaturobjekttypen.
Här är de alias som (om det har angetts för klasser av objekttypen Signatur) används av M-Files i olika faser av elektronisk signering:
M-Files.QMS.Signature.Class.Empty
M-Files.QMS.Signature.Class.Executed
M-Files.QMS.Signature.Class.Invalidated
Behörigheter
Metadatadefinitioner (objekttyp och egenskapsdefinitioner) som skapats för objektet för den automatiska signaturen bör vara säkra. Det ska inte vara möjligt att skapa signaturobjekt manuellt eller ändras deras metadata. Även den egenskapsdefinition som binder det signerade objektet till signaturen måste vara säker. Om du använder M-Files Compliance Kit finns dessa definitioner redan tillgängliga.
Separat signaturobjekt
När du har skapat de nödvändiga definitionerna och valt att skapa ett separat objekt för signaturen skapas objektet automatiskt efter signering.
Namnet på signaturobjektet skapas automatiskt från signaturens orsak, den som signerar och tidsstämpel.
Annan metadata för signaturobjektet skapas automatiskt utifrån signaturdefinitionerna.